UserSplit Cutover Drift: the extracted account service and the legacy Marigold monolith user module are reporting divergent record counts during dual-write. This fires when drift exceeds 0.5% over 15 minutes. New team members should not replay writes manually. Reconciliation steps and the rollback procedure are documented on the internal page.

wiki page, tajog-fafog: https://gitlab.paliqsys.corp/dash/display/job/853dd6fcbf54

## Changelog — Lanternleaf Reports v4.2

Heads up, support folks: we renamed `EXPORT_TZ_MODE` to `REPORT_EXPORT_TIMEZONE`. Same behavior, clearer name. If a customer says their CSV exports shifted by a few hours after upgrading, they probably still have the old key set — the new one silently falls back to UTC. Accepted values are `utc`, `account`, and `viewer`. The old key is ignored entirely as of this release, no warning logged (yes, we know, fix coming). The export-service signing secret is defined on the next line.

sealed setting: VAULT_KEY20=69e2a0b23f1a79fbf692

Handover note — Crumbwheel order cutoffs.

Welcome aboard. The bakery cutoff rule in Crumbwheel closes same-day orders at 14:00 local to each storefront, not UTC — this has bitten us twice. Holiday overrides live in the calendar service and take precedence silently, so always check there first when a cutoff looks wrong. To unlock the calendar service's admin console after a restart, enter the recovery passphrase below.

vault phrase of bagap-bahaf = silion-pelox-sorox-casdor-quenwyn-fraax-eliox-praael-kelion-quenvan-kasox-rusael-norius-belvan